Hi all, the cover that covers the top when it is down, has a couple of stains on it, i used plain water and it did not come off, any suggestions as to what else I can use other than water without discouloring it or making it worse.?thanks

What is the stain? If it's oil based than it might be tough to remove completely. Try using soapy water & a sponge, scrub the spot really hard. Or try some "mild" cleaner like Simple Green on the spot.

Personally I never use my top boot cover, it's a PITA & doesn't really do any useful other than "slightly" smooth out the looks of the car
